Context
Auction.com needed an Android experience that could support property search, saved properties, auction monitoring, and bidding for users who were increasingly mobile-first. The challenge was to create parity with the iOS experience while respecting Android interaction patterns and the needs of real estate auction users.
- Who used the app: Real estate investors and bidders searching Auction.com for residential foreclosure and bank-owned properties.
- Key tasks: Search and filter listings, save properties, monitor auction status, review property details, place bids, and act on outbid notifications.
- Why mobile mattered: Auctions run on tight timelines. Users needed to check bidding status and respond away from a desktop — especially when tracking multiple properties or reacting quickly to outbid alerts.

Platform Design Decisions
The goal was a native Android product — not a direct port of iOS. Each decision balanced platform familiarity, cross-surface consistency where users needed it, and the tasks investors rely on during live auctions.
Android conventions where they helped
Navigation, touch targets, and interaction patterns followed Android guidelines when they made common tasks faster to learn — especially for users who lived on Android day to day.
Consistency where it mattered
Shared terminology, bidding status language, and core workflows aligned with iOS and mobile web so users could move between surfaces without relearning the product — while layouts adapted to each platform.
Auction-critical hierarchy
Property search, bidding status, price, and auction timing led the visual hierarchy so users could scan active deals and decide what needed attention first.
Urgency in notifications and outbid states
Outbid alerts and status updates were designed around clear next actions — helping users respond quickly when an auction window was closing or they had been outbid.
